Wash and roughly chop the apples. Mix in cinnamon, aniseed, sultanas and nuts. Put flour in a bowl and add salt. Stir together apple juice, yeast and honey, add to flour and knead well. Finally, fold in the butter. Cover the dough and leave to prove until it has doubled in size. Make portions with a spoon, roll in wholemeal flour and leave to rise on a floured baking tray. Bake the rolls for 25 to 30 minutes in an oven pre-heated to 180° C (with fan).
